首页 > 编程知识 正文

mysql建数据库是选择gbk,在MySQL中创建数据库

时间:2023-12-27 22:26:50 阅读:324989 作者:ZNFF

本文目录一览:

怎么在mysql数据库中建一个编码为gbk的数据库

两种方法:

1.修改服务器字符集为gbk,然后创建数据库让其继承服务器gbk字符集

2.创建数据库时指定字符集为gbk

详见参考资料

如何设置Mysql数据库默认的字符集编码为GBK

1、更改服务器的编码方式,在终端输入以下命令:

mysqld

--character-set-server=gbk

--collation-server=gbk_chinese_ci;

2、更改某个数据库的编码方式

mysql

-u

root

-p

alter

database

character

set

gbk

collate

gbk_chinese_ci;

3、在创建数据库时指定编码:

mysql

-u

root

-p

create

database

db_name

character

set

gbk

collate

gbk_chinese_ci;

4、更改某个表的编码方式

mysql

-u

root

-p

db_name

alter

table

table_name

convert

to

charachter

set

gbk

collate

gbk_chinese_ci;

5、在创建表时指定编码方式

mysql

-u

root

-p

db_name

create

table

table_name

(....)

character

set

gbk

collate

gbk_chinese_ci;

6、更改某行的编码方式

mysql

-u

root

-p

db_name

alter

table

table_name

modify

column_name

varchar(20)

character

set

gbk

collate

gbk_chinese_ci;

7、在创建列时指定编码方式:

/prepre

name="code"

class="sql"mysql

-u

root

-p

db_name

create

table

table_name

(...,

col1

varchar(20)

character

set

gbk

collate

gbk_chinese_ci,

...)

character

set

utf8

collate

utf8_general_ci;

mysql数据库的字符集为“GBK”,页面显示要求用“UTF-8”字符集,该怎么办?

方法1:卸载你现在的mysql,把你的mysql数据库重新安装一次,在下图选择utf-8

方法2:C:Program FilesMySQLMySQL Server 5.0---这个是我的数据库的安装路径

里面有个my.ini这样的文件,用记事本或者其他能打开的工具打开,我用的是EditPlus打开的,找到里面的57行和81行这两处修改(或者你用Ctrl+F查找你的“GBK”),把GBK替换成utf8,注意是utf8,然后保存,前提是你要有管理员权限。然后重启你的mysql即可,

个人推荐你用第2种方法祝你成功,给力采纳哟!

mysql 建数据库 是选择gbk _bin 好还是选择Gbk_chinese_ci 好? 两者有什么优缺点?

gbk _bin是Gbk_chinese_ci的子集,两者实际上基本一样,默认是Gbk_chinese_ci。选择哪个不影响储存。

mysql数据库语言编码设置gbk还是utf8哪个好

gbk适合大量中文数据的情况,utf-8兼容性更强,适合绝大多数语言。目前大部分都采用utf-8编码。希望对你有帮助。

版权声明:该文观点仅代表作者本人。处理文章:请发送邮件至 三1五14八八95#扣扣.com 举报,一经查实,本站将立刻删除。